Noun[edit]

muchudd m (uncountable)

  1. jet; agate.

Adjective[edit]

muchudd (feminine singular muchudd, plural muchudd, equative mor fuchudd, comparative mwy muchudd, superlative mwyaf muchudd)

  1. jet, jet-black
